Description
- Lecithin is used for preparation of vesicle suspensions
- Major membrane phospholipid in eukaryotic cells
- Serves as a reservoir for several lipid messengers
- Source of the bioactive lipids lysophosphatidylcholine, phosphatidic acid, diacylglycerol, lysophosphatidylcholine, plateletactivating factor, and arachidonic acid
